Multiplexing is a technique that is used to send more than one call over a single line.
Multiplexing:
- Networks employ multiplexing as a technique to combine many digital or analog signals into a single composite signal that is transmitted via a common media, like a radio wave or fiber optic cable.
- Multiplexing allows us to send a lot of signals to one media, which is an advantage.
- Multiple signals will need to be handled simultaneously through this channel, which can be a physical medium like a coaxial, metallic conductor, or a wireless link.
- As a result, transmission costs can be decreased.
A type of signal transmission known as "digital transmission" involves the discrete-time variation of two values, one of which represents the binary number "0" and the other "1."
Infrared transmission is the term used to describe electromagnetic radiation with wavelengths greater than visible light but shorter than radio waves.
Information is converted into a digital representation through the process of digitization.
The distribution of audio, video and multimedia content in real-time or on-demand over the Internet is made possible by streaming media technologies.
